What Are Essential Oils?

Essential oils are highly concentrated extracts that capture a plant’s natural essence and fragrance.

These oils are obtained through methods like steam distillation and cold pressing. Each essential oil has a unique chemical composition that determines its benefits and aroma. Popular essential oils include lavender, tea tree, peppermint, eucalyptus, and lemon.

Top Benefits of Essential Oils

1. Stress Relief and Relaxation

Essential oils such as lavender, chamomile, and sandalwood are well-known for their calming effects. Aromatherapy using these oils can help reduce stress, ease anxiety, and promote better sleep. Simply inhaling these oils or diffusing them can create a peaceful environment.

2. Skincare and Haircare

Many essential oils offer benefits for skin and hair.

  • Tea tree oil: Known for its antibacterial properties, it helps treat acne and other skin issues.
  • Rose oil: Hydrates and rejuvenates the skin, leaving it soft and glowing.
  • Peppermint and rosemary oils: Stimulate the scalp, promoting healthy hair growth and reducing dandruff.

3. Pain and Muscle Relief

Oils like peppermint and eucalyptus have cooling properties that help relieve headaches, muscle aches, and joint pain. Applying diluted oils to the affected area can provide quick relief from discomfort.

4. Boosting Immunity

Certain oils, like lemon, oregano, and clove, have antimicrobial and immune-boosting properties. Diffusing these oils in your living space can purify the air and protect against seasonal illnesses.

5. Improved Focus and Energy

Citrus oils such as orange, lemon, and grapefruit are known for their uplifting and energizing effects. Diffusing these oils in your workspace can enhance concentration, increase alertness, and boost productivity.

How to Use Essential Oils

1. Aromatherapy

Use a diffuser to disperse essential oils into the air, creating a soothing or energizing atmosphere. This method is ideal for stress relief, mood enhancement, and improving indoor air quality.

2. Topical Application

Essential oils can be applied to the skin after diluting them with a carrier oil like coconut or jojoba oil. This method is effective for massages, skincare, and pain relief. Always conduct a patch test before applying the oil to avoid skin irritation.

3. Inhalation

Inhale essential oils directly from the bottle or add a few drops to a bowl of hot water. Cover your head with a towel and breathe deeply to relieve congestion and improve respiratory health.

4. Bath Soaks

Adding essential oils to a warm bath can help relax your body and mind. For better results, mix the oils with Epsom salts or a carrier oil before adding them to the water.

5. DIY Products

Essential oils can be used to create homemade skincare products, hair masks, or natural cleaning solutions. Adding a few drops to lotions, shampoos, or sprays can enhance their effectiveness and provide a pleasant scent.

Safety Tips for Using Essential Oils

  • Dilution: Always dilute essential oils with a carrier oil before applying them to the skin. Undiluted oils can cause irritation or allergic reactions.
  • Patch Test: Before using a new essential oil, perform a patch test to check for sensitivity. Apply a small amount of diluted oil to your skin and wait 24 hours.
  • Ingestion: Avoid ingesting essential oils unless under the guidance of a healthcare professional, as many oils are not safe for internal use.
  • Storage: Store essential oils in dark glass bottles, away from direct sunlight and heat, to preserve their potency and shelf life.
  • Consult a Professional: If you are pregnant, nursing, or have a medical condition, consult a doctor before using essential oils.
